#ifndef _D_TIME_H_
#define _D_TIME_H_
#include "common.h"
#include <sys/time.h>
class Time {
private:
struct timeval tv;
struct timeval getCurrentTime() const;
public:
// The time value is initialized so that it represents the time at which
// this object was created.
Time();
Time(const Time& time);
Time& operator=(const Time& time);
~Time();
// Makes this object's time value up to date.
void reset();
bool elapsed(int sec) const;
bool elapsedInMillis(int millis) const;
int difference() const;
long long int differenceInMillis() const;
// Returns true if this object's time value is zero.
bool isZero() const { return tv.tv_sec == 0 && tv.tv_usec == 0; }
long long int getTimeInMicros() const {
return (long long int)tv.tv_sec*1000*1000+tv.tv_usec;
}
long long int getTimeInMillis() const {
return (long long int)tv.tv_sec*1000+tv.tv_usec/1000;
}
// Returns this object's time value in seconds.
int getTime() const {
return tv.tv_sec;
}
void setTimeInSec(int sec);
bool isNewer(const Time& time) const;
};
#endif // _D_TIME_H_
